One board foot measures 12 inches x 12 inches x 1 inch and in theory, one cubic foot contains 12 … WebDiameter: All the major log rules use the small end diameter, inside the bark, as the basic size measurement. If the log is not perfectly round, then two readings are taken at 90 degrees to each other and averaged. Length: The log length is the length to the last full foot (especially for hardwood logs). Do not round up to the next foot.

Weba log on a board-foot basis and requires that each log be scaled according to a specific log rule. A log rule is a mathematical formula or table that gives an estimate of the net yield of lumber in board feet for logs given a specific diameter and length. Log rules generally have allowances for losses in yield due to saw kerf, producing slabs ... Always plan to buy extra to make sure you're … WebFor example, a 1×12 that is 1 foot long would be calculated as: Board Feet = ( (1x12x1)/12) = 1 board foot. This may seem confusing, as the actual dimensions of a 1×12 are 3/4 x 11 1/4. This would give an “actual” board footage of: Board Feet = ( (3/4×11.25×1)/12) = 0.703 board feet.
